May 17, 1965
Requiem high Mass will be offered Tuesday morning at 9 in Immaculate Conception Church, Irwin, for Mrs. Madalena Gianola Acalotto. Interment will follow in Irwin Catholic Cemetery. Mrs. Acalotto, 83, 105 Main St., Hahntown, Irwin, died Saturday evening at the home of her daughter, Mrs. Emma Hoczur, followed a lingering illness. She was born May 31, 1881 in Italy. Her husband Attilio preceded her in death in August, 1958. She was a member of Immaculate Conception Church, Irwin. Women of the Moose Chapter 171 of Irwin and Italian Ladies Auxiliary. Surviving are the following children: Dominic, Adams Hill; Till, Hawaii; Mrs. Alda Ridl, Irwin, and Mrs. Hoczur; seven grandchildren; four sisters and a brother, Mrs. Angelina Gacoma, Mrs. Serondina Milanesia, Mrs. Theresa Marco, Mrs. Rosina Ciochetto, Giovanni Gianola, all of Lorenze, Italy. Friends are being received at Joseph F. Ott Funeral Home, 504 Oak St., Irwin, 2-5, 7-10.
